Automator quarantine Soluzione alternativa per gatekeeper?

1

Sto utilizzando il mio certificato per sviluppatori per firmare le app di Automator tramite la finestra di dialogo Esporta, tuttavia quando distribuisci queste app (al di fuori del Mac App Store) via email, Gatekeeper continua a contrassegnare le mie app come da uno sviluppatore sconosciuto. Raccolgo dai forum degli sviluppatori Apple che le app non app store sono contrassegnate con una quarantena di qualche tipo.

Spero di vedere se qualcun altro ha riscontrato un problema simile e trovato una soluzione alternativa. Forse un applescript che posso aggiungere al mio flusso di lavoro che rimuoverà quella quarantena?

    
posta Andrew J O'Melia 19.02.2014 - 18:59
fonte

1 risposta

0

Verifica firma

Controlla che l'applicazione di Automator sia stata firmata correttamente. Fallo usando lo strumento da riga di comando codesign . Utilizza il seguente comando in Terminal.app per visualizzare la firma del codice associata alla tua applicazione:

codesign -d -vvvv /Applications/MyGreatAutomator.app

L'output menziona il tuo identificatore sviluppatore? In caso contrario, rivisita in che modo firma la tua domanda in quanto potrebbe essere interrotta.

Bandiera quarantena

Il contrassegno di quarantena viene applicato ai file scaricati da Internet. Questo flag può essere rimosso manualmente utilizzando questo comando:

xattr -r -d com.apple.quarantine /Applications/MyGreatAutomator.app
    
risposta data 19.02.2014 - 19:09
fonte

Leggi altre domande sui tag